Guyana Amazon Warriors made it three from three after hammering Lahore Qalandars by 53 runs at the Providence Stadium on Sunday night.

The Amazon Warriors made 164 for 9, with Rahmanullah Gurbaz getting 65.

In reply, Lahore were bundled out for just 111 in the 18th over, with Gudakesh Motie grabbing four wickets.
